What Causes This Problem
- Frozen water lines can burst and cause leaks behind ice makers.
- Loose or disconnected water supply hoses leak under refrigerators.
- Clogged or damaged drain tubes lead to water overflow and leaks.
- Faulty or aging water inlet valves fail and create continuous leaks.
- Poor installation or maintenance increases risk of ice maker water leaks.
Augusta’s humid climate near the Savannah River often worsens water damage from ice maker leaks by encouraging mold growth if cleanup is delayed. Residents should address appliance leaks promptly since moisture can easily penetrate cabinetry and flooring. What Signs Indicate That Ice Maker Leak Cleanup Is Needed?
Signs include pooling water near the refrigerator, musty odors, swollen cabinetry, or visible mold. Early identification helps reduce damage and restoration costs.
Can Ice Maker Leak Cleanup Prevent Mold Growth?
Yes, prompt cleanup and comprehensive drying remove moisture that mold requires, helping protect your home’s health and structure effectively.
How Long Does Ice Maker Leak Cleanup Usually Take?
Cleanup times vary but typically range from a few hours for minor leaks to several days if extensive drying and repairs are needed.
